WebApp和原生安卓App都有它們自身安卓app制作的開發難度。下面是它們各自的原理和詳細介紹:
WebApp是一種基于Web技術開發的應用程序,它通過HTML、CSS和JS等一系列的Web技術來實現功能。WebApp通常在瀏覽器中運行,或者集成到原生應用中作為一個網頁活動頁面。相較于原生應用,WebApp有一些優勢:開發成本低、跨平臺、可即時更新等。但是,也有一些缺點:性能相對較差、遠離本地環境、離線數據存儲難等。
而原生安卓App則是專門為安卓設備開發的應用程序。它直接擁有設備的底層資源,能夠更好地利用硬
件資源,帶來更好的用戶體驗。原生應用的優勢包括:高性能、更好的用戶體驗和交互、強大的本地存儲等等。但也有一些不足之處,例如:開發成本高、跨平臺性較差、需要審核等。
就開發難度而言,WebApp可能更為簡單一些。Web技術本身較為成熟,而開發成本也相對較低。但是,如果要實現一些高端功能,WebApp的開發難度很可能會增加。而原生應安卓app用則需要在特定的開發環境下,使用特定的技術來進行開發,這導致開發成本與難度較高。但是,一旦習慣了開發環境和技術棧,原生應用的開發將變得更為容易。